十一岁学什么编程

十一岁学什么编程

对于11岁的孩子来说,学习编程的最佳选择包括:1、Python;2、Scratch;3、JavaScript。在这些选项中, Python 因其简单的语法和广泛的应用领域而显得尤为重要。Python不仅是初学者入门编程的绝佳选择,也是目前世界上最受欢迎的编程语言之一。它拥有清晰、易读的代码风格,使得即使是编程新手也能轻松掌握。此外,Python的应用范围覆盖了数据分析、人工智能、网站开发等多个热门方向,为孩子日后的学习和发展打下了坚实的基础。

一、PYTHON的重要性

Python以其简单直观的语法获得了广泛的认可和使用,尤其适合编程初学者。对于11岁的孩子来说,Python不仅可以帮助他们迅速理解编程的基础概念,如变量、循环、条件语句等,而且还能激发他们对编程的兴趣。Python社区庞大活跃,提供了丰富的学习资源和工具,便于孩子学习和实践。从小游戏制作到简单的自动化脚本,Python都能提供一条从入门到进阶的顺畅路径。

二、SCRATCH的玩中学

Scratch是一种专为儿童设计的编程语言,通过拖拽编程积木的方式让孩子们能够轻松入门编程世界。它不仅能培养孩子们的逻辑思维能力和解决问题的能力,而且还能激发他们的创造力。在Scratch社区中,孩子们可以互相分享和试玩彼此创作的游戏和故事,这种互动性和趣味性使得学习过程更加生动和吸引人。

三、JAVASCRIPT和网页设计

JavaScript作为一种广泛应用于网页开发的编程语言,对于想要探索如何制作和设计网页的孩子来说,是一个绝佳的学习选项。通过学习JavaScript,孩子们可以了解到网页是如何构建的,以及如何通过编写代码来实现网页的动态效果。这种技能不仅对他们理解计算机科学的基本原理有帮助,而且也能提升他们对数字世界的认识和掌控能力。

四、学习编程的益处

学习编程不仅能够提高孩子的计算机操作能力和解决问题的能力,而且还能够培养他们的逻辑思维和创新思维。在如今这个数字化时代,掌握编程知识和技能已经成为了一项重要的素养。对于孩子们来说,早早开始接触和学习编程,无疑能为他们将来的学习和职业生涯增添宝贵的竞争力。

五、如何选择适合的编程课程

选择适合11岁孩子的编程课程时,家长和教育者应该考虑到孩子的兴趣、学习习惯以及目前的技术水平。对于初学者来说,以游戏和项目为导向的学习方法会更有趣味性和吸引力,能够更好地激发孩子的学习热情。此外,参与在线编程社区和比赛不仅能增加学习的互动性,也能让孩子体验到与同龄人交流和合作的乐趣。

六、未来的可能性

随着科技的不断进步和编程教育资源的日益丰富,学习编程已经成为了许多孩子成长路径中的一部分。未来,这些拥有编程技能的孩子们将有更多机会参与到创新项目和颠覆性技术的开发中,不论是人工智能、机器人技术还是新的软件开发领域。因此,为孩子选择一门合适的编程语言学习,无疑是为他们打开通往未来无限可能性的大门。

相关问答FAQs:

Q: 十一岁的孩子适合学什么编程?

A: 十一岁的孩子正处于学习和发展的黄金时期,编程是一项有趣且有益的技能,可以帮助他们培养逻辑思维和问题解决能力。以下是一些适合十一岁孩子学习的编程语言和平台:

  1. Scratch: Scratch是一款针对儿童和初学者设计的图形化编程语言。通过拖拽方块代码来创建动画、游戏和故事,十一岁的孩子可以轻松入门编程,培养创造力和逻辑思维。

  2. Python: Python是一种易学易用的文本编程语言,适合十一岁的孩子进一步学习编程。它具有简单的语法和广泛的应用领域,包括游戏开发、网页设计和数据分析等。有许多针对儿童的Python教程和平台,可以帮助他们更好地理解编程概念。

  3. Arduino: 如果你的孩子对硬件编程感兴趣,那么Arduino是一个很好的选择。Arduino是一种开源电子原型平台,可以让孩子们学习如何设计和控制电子电路,并通过编写代码来操控各种传感器和执行器。这对于培养孩子的创造力和解决问题的能力非常有帮助。

无论选择哪种编程语言或平台,关键是让孩子以兴趣为驱动,提供适合他们年龄和能力水平的学习材料和项目。编程不仅可以锻炼他们的思维能力,还可以为他们未来的学习和职业生涯奠定坚实的基础。

Q: 学习编程对十一岁的孩子有哪些益处?

A: 学习编程对十一岁的孩子有许多益处,包括:

  1. 提高逻辑思维和问题解决能力:编程需要思考和分解问题,然后使用逻辑推理和反馈机制来解决。这可以帮助孩子培养良好的问题分析和解决能力。

  2. 培养创造力和想象力:编程允许孩子们创造自己的世界,通过代码来实现自己的创意和想象。这可以激发他们的创造力和创新能力。

  3. 提升数学和科学知识:编程涉及到许多数学和科学概念,如算法、逻辑运算和数据分析。通过编程,孩子可以应用和巩固在学校学到的数学和科学知识。

  4. 培养团队合作和沟通能力:在编程项目中,孩子们常常需要与其他人合作,共同解决问题。这可以帮助他们学会团队合作、分享想法和有效沟通。

  5. 提前了解职业领域:学习编程可以让孩子了解计算机科学和技术行业的基本工作原理和概念。这对于未来选择职业方向非常有帮助,尤其是在数字化时代,计算机技术已经渗透到各个行业。

总的来说,学习编程不仅能够培养孩子的思维能力和创造力,还可以为他们未来的学习和职业道路提供更多机会和选择。

Q: 如何为十一岁的孩子选择适合的编程学习资源?

A: 为十一岁的孩子选择合适的编程学习资源需要考虑以下几个因素:

  1. 易学性和趣味性:对于刚开始学习编程的孩子来说,选择易学且趣味性高的编程语言和平台非常重要。图形化编程语言如Scratch非常适合初学者,而Python则是一个学习曲线较平缓且功能丰富的文本编程语言。

  2. 年龄和能力适配:确保选择的学习资源与孩子的年龄和能力相匹配。有些编程平台和教材专为儿童设计,提供更易于理解的指导和项目。

  3. 互动性和实践性:寻找具有互动性和实践性的学习资源,让孩子们可以亲自动手编写代码、制作项目和解决问题。这将帮助他们更好地理解编程概念和巩固所学知识。

  4. 教育价值和好奇心引导:选择那些不仅有趣而且有教育价值的学习资源,可以帮助孩子们培养好奇心和探索精神。这些资源可能包括具有挑战性的项目、编程社区以及与其他编程爱好者的互动。

最重要的是,鼓励孩子选择自己感兴趣的主题和项目进行学习,并根据他们的进展和兴趣调整学习资源。与其他编程学习者和爱好者共享经验,定期参加编程活动和比赛也是很好的学习方式。

文章标题:十一岁学什么编程,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1590097

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• DevOps项目成功的关键指标有哪些

    成功的DevOps项目通常表现在几个关键指标上,这些指标是衡量项目是否高效运行以及满足业务需求的重要依据。1、部署频率:一方面要确保快速迭代;2、变更前后的服务稳定性:衡量部署变更时的风险;3、恢复时间:即系统故障后恢复正常运行所需的时间短;4、成功率:反映项目变更的成功概率;5、自动化水平:提高一…

    2023年12月13日
    37900
  • 在编程中沙漏模块叫什么

    沙漏模块在编程中被称为沙漏架构(Hourglass Model),它是一种强调组件间解耦的设计模式。在这个架构中,一个宽泛的上层接口依赖于一个细窄的中间层,而后者又支持着一个宽泛的底层接口。这种设计允许上层和底层相互独立发展,只要中间层的接口保持稳定。这种模式在系统设计中非常有用,因为它允许各个部分…

    2024年4月27日
    3900
  • java使用什么编程

    Java使用面向对象编程范式(OOP),它通过类和对象的概念来建模现实世界。在面向对象编程中,类是创建对象的蓝图或模板,而对象是类的实例。这种方法具有几个显著优势,如代码重用性、模块性和易于管理。在Java中实现面向对象编程,依赖于几个关键概念,包括封装、继承、多态和抽象。其中封装是指隐藏对象的内部…

    2024年5月2日
    4000
  • python新手用什么软件编程

    Python新手应该使用的编程软件主要有五种:1、Visual Studio Code(VS Code)、2、PyCharm、3、Jupyter Notebook、4、Thonny、5、Atom。其中,Visual Studio Code(VS Code) 是一个轻量级但功能强大的源代码编辑器,支持…

    2024年5月7日
    2500
  • 高端机床的数控编程是什么

    高端机床的数控编程是用来精准控制机床运作的过程,通过软件实施对机床各项操作的指令编写和实施。在数控编程中,1、 编写符合机床特性的程序代码 是关键环节,它要求编程人员不仅掌握机械加工知识,还需熟悉计算机编程语言和机床本身的工作原理。 数控编程在提高机床加工精度、效率和自动化水平方面起着至关重要的作用…

    2024年4月27日
    4700
  • 思美创编程用什么电脑

    思美创编程通常依赖于1、性能强大、2、稳定性高和3、具有足够存储空间的电脑。在这三点中,性能强大尤为重要,因为它直接影响到编程任务的执行速度和效率。性能主要体现在处理器的速度、计算能力以及内存的大小上。一个高性能的处理器,如最新的Intel i7或i9系列,AMD的Ryzen系列,能够更快地编译代码…

    2024年4月27日
    4500
  • 想学电脑编程学什么好

    学习编程应依次掌握:1、基础逻辑能力;2、一门主流编程语言;3、算法与数据结构;4、软件开发生命周期。专注于一门主流编程语言,如Python或Java,能够为编程学习和实践提供坚实的基础。这些语言因其广泛的应用和支持社区,成为入门与深入学习的首选。通过掌握一门语言,可以学习编程的核心概念,如变量、循…

    2024年4月27日
    3600
  • 中级编程课学什么好

    中级编程课程的主要内容包括1、数据结构与算法、2、面向对象编程、3、版本控制系统、4、数据库与SQL、5、一门专门的编程语言深入学习。 其中,数据结构与算法是编程的基础,它帮助理解如何有效地存储和处理数据。这一部分通常包括了解基本的数据结构(如链表、树、图等)和算法(如排序和搜索算法),以及更高级的…

    2024年5月7日
    900
  • 编程时代有什么

    在当前的数字化时代,编程已成为社会发展和科技进步的重要推动力。主要表现在1、创新引领、2、就业机会增加、3、生活方式改变。特别地,创新引领作为编程时代的显著特点,它不仅促使了新技术的诞生,还推动了各行各业的革新。通过编程,开发者可以设计出前所未有的应用程序和服务,如人工智能、大数据分析和物联网等,这…

    2024年5月2日
    3400
  • 电脑编程是要干些什么工作

    电脑编程主要涉及三个方面:1、创建和维护软件应用;2、分析和解决问题;3、与数据交换和处理。创建和维护软件应用这一点尤为重要,因为它是整个编程领域的基础。从网页开发到移动应用,再到庞大的企业级系统,软件应用贯穿于我们生活的各个方面。编程人员需使用各种编程语言来编写、测试、调试和维护软件,以满足不同用…

    2024年4月27日
    3900

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部